What is a risky investment?
A risky investment is where the chance of underperformance or losing all your investment is higher than average. Risky investments often offer investors the potential for higher returns for accepting a high level of risk. A risky investment does not have a guaranteed return. For example, holding a stock is generally considered riskier than holding government bonds.

Protection against any potential loss
Another benefit of avoiding risky investment is the protection against any potential loss. If you invest in a low-risk investment, the return may be low, but if things don’t go as you had planned, then the loss will not be devastating. Investment risk is usually defined by underperformance or loss of capital relative to expectations. Low-risk investments are mostly stable and predictable, meaning that chances of losing your money are minimal, and even if you make losses, the impact will not be so huge. When you invest in a low-risk investment, you will not have to worry about going bankrupt overnight because your principal is protected.
